Born on the racetrack in 1963, the Rolex Cosmographโ€ฏDaytona remains the most coveted steel chronograph on the planet. Current references 116500LN and 126500LN pair a 40โ€ฏmm 904L Oystersteel case with a Cerachrom tachymeter bezel and the inโ€‘house calibreโ€ฏ4130/4131, delivering 72โ€ฏhours of Superlativeโ€‘Chronometer precision (โ€‘2/+2โ€ฏs per day). Why Collect a Steel Daytona?

Edge Details
Icon Status From Paul Newmanโ€™s auction record to modern hype, the Daytona is the benchmark sports chronograph.
Cerachrom Bezel Scratchโ€‘proof ceramic tachymeter resists UV fading; steel insert models ceased in 2016.
Investment Grade Even in a cooling market, steel Daytonas trade 30โ€“50โ€ฏ% above MSRP due to limited production.
Technical Merit Verticalโ€‘clutch chronograph, Parachrom hairspring, 70โ€‘h power reserve, 100โ€ฏm waterโ€‘resistance.

Stainless Steel Daytona FAQ

How much is a stainless steel Rolex Daytona?

A new stainlessโ€‘steel Daytona (ref.โ€ฏ126500LN) lists at โ‰ˆโ€ฏUSโ€ฏ$15,100. Because supply is far below demand, preโ€‘owned fullโ€‘set pieces trade on the secondary market for $28โ€ฏkโ€ฏโ€“โ€ฏ$34โ€ฏk, while the earlier 116500LN ranges $27โ€ฏkโ€‘$32โ€ฏk depending on dial color, year and condition.

Why is the stainless steel Daytona so expensive?

Rolex makes comparatively few steel Daytonas, releases them only through tightlyโ€‘controlled AD allocations, and never meets global demand. That supplyโ€‘demand gapโ€”combined with the modelโ€™s racing heritage, ultraโ€‘reliable inโ€‘house chronograph calibre 4130/4131, and strong auction track recordโ€”drives secondaryโ€‘market prices to twoโ€‘plus times MSRP.
